Post-copulatory genetic matchmaking: HLA-dependent effects of cervical mucus on human sperm function
19 Aug 2020
Abstract excerpt
Several studies have demonstrated that women show pre-copulatory mating preferences for human leucocyte antigen (HLA)-dissimilar men. A fascinating, yet unexplored, possibility is that the ultimate mating bias towards HLA-dissimilar partners could occur after copulation, at the gamete level.
